She is intended to spend a week in Africa at the end of March as part of the United States deepenings its allies as China and Russia form alliances. “The trip will strengthen the United States’ partnerships throughout Africa and advance our shared efforts on security and economic prosperity,” said a statement from the vice president’s spokesperson, Kirsten Allen. Upon arrival, she stepped off the plane with her husband Douglas Emhoff and was greeted on arrival with a handshake by Vice President Bawumia. She mentioned her array to vists first to Ghana, then to Tanzania, then to Zambia. According to her, she is very excited about the future of Africa as it is predicted that by 2050, 1 in every 4 people will be living on the continent of Africa. She intends to address the climate crisis, and work on increasing investments, facilitation of economic growth and opportunity, specifically empowerment of women and girl, youth, digital security, and more.
